EDS Factory Sealed Tumbler Switches - PN

On Request

The EDS Series factory sealed tumbler switches are specifically designed for environments classified as hazardous due to the presence of ignitable vapors, gases, or combustible dusts. These switches are particularly suitable for use in chemical and petrochemical plants, refineries, and other process industries. Constructed with a malleable iron body and covers, these switches feature a sealing chamber made from copper-free aluminum in select models. The handle is made from nylon 6/6, while the optional nameplate mounting bracket is crafted from corrosion-resistant stainless steel, providing durability and facilitating easy circuit identification without the need for costly field modifications. The switches come with a triple-coat finish comprising zinc electroplate, chromate, and epoxy powder coat, enhancing their resistance to harsh environmental conditions. They meet rigorous standards, including NEC and CEC certifications, allowing operation in Class I, Division 1 and 2 (Groups B, C, D) as well as Class II and III environments.

Unicode 2 Series 16 Amp Switches - PN

On Request

The Unicode 2 Series 16 Amp switches are engineered for enhanced safety in industrial applications. These switches facilitate circuit control and selection, making them ideal for integration with contactors or magnetic starters for motor management. With compliance to NEC, CEC, ATEX, and IECEx standards, the devices are rated for Class I, Division 2 and Zone 1 environments, ensuring reliable operation in hazardous conditions. Constructed with a polyamide body and silver alloy contacts, these switches operate effectively across a broad temperature range, from -55 °C to +80 °C (-67 °F to +176 °F) for both NEC and CEC environments, as well as ATEX and IECEx specifications. Handles are rated for -20 °C to +55 °C (-4 °F to +131 °F), providing durability and functionality in various operational settings.

Nonmetallic Tumbler Switch - PN

On Request

The nonmetallic tumbler switch, identified as PN N1DC75F3W, is specifically engineered to mitigate the risk of arcing in environments where flammable gases, vapors, or combustible dust may be present. This switch is suitable for use in various industrial settings, including chemical and petrochemical plants, as well as refineries.Constructed from 30% glass-reinforced thermoplastic polyetherimide, the switch features Teflon™ coated stainless steel cover bolts and Mylar™ nameplates, ensuring durability and resistance to corrosion. The design includes a nameplate mounting bracket that simplifies the identification of circuits, eliminating the need for field modifications such as drilling or tapping.This unit meets stringent safety standards, certified under NEC for Class I, Division 1 and 2, Groups C and D, and NEMA ratings of 3R, 4X, 7CD, and 12, ensuring reliable performance in demanding conditions.
